Dictyocha
Taxonomy
Dictyocha was named by Ehrenberg (1837). It is extant.
It was assigned to Cannorhaphida by Martin (1904); and to Dictyochaceae by Lemmermann (1901), Abbott and Ernissee (1983), Chrétiennot-Dinet et al. (1993).

Age range
Maximum range based only on fossils: base of the Paleocene to the top of the Pleistocene or 66.00000 to 0.01170 Ma
Minimum age of oldest fossil (stem group age): 56.0 Ma
